Linux系统字符集修改指南:轻松切换至所需编码
linux 修改系统字符集

首页 2024-12-24 06:02:58



Linux 系统字符集修改:全面指南与深度解析 在当今的信息化时代,字符集的选择和配置对于操作系统的稳定性和应用程序的兼容性至关重要

    特别是在Linux系统中,字符集不仅影响文件的读取与写入,还关系到网络通信、数据库操作以及用户界面的显示

    因此,正确修改Linux系统的字符集,是每一位系统管理员和开发者必须掌握的重要技能

    本文将详细阐述如何在Linux系统中修改字符集,同时深入解析字符集的基本概念、选择原则以及修改过程中可能遇到的问题和解决方案

     一、字符集的基本概念 字符集(Character Set)是文字和符号的集合,用于计算机内部表示和处理文本信息

    常见的字符集有ASCII、ISO-8859-1(Latin-1)、GB2312(简体中文)、Big5(繁体中文)、UTF-8等

    其中,UTF-8(Unicode Transformation Format-8 bits)因其兼容性好、支持全球所有文字而被广泛使用

     在Linux系统中,字符集主要通过以下两个层面进行设置: 1.系统级字符集:影响整个系统的文本处理,如文件名的编码、系统日志的编码等

     2.用户级字符集:影响特定用户的终端环境、应用程序的文本显示等

     二、字符集的选择原则 选择合适的字符集,需要考虑以下几个因素: 1.兼容性:确保所选择的字符集能够兼容当前系统上的所有应用程序和数据文件

     2.国际化支持:如果系统需要支持多种语言,应选择像UTF-8这样的国际化字符集

     3.性能:虽然字符集对系统性能的影响有限,但在某些特定应用场景下(如大文本处理),仍需考虑字符集的内存占用和处理效率

     4.易用性:字符集的选择应便于管理和维护,避免频繁更换带来的复杂性

     三、Linux系统字符集修改步骤 1. 修改系统级字符集 系统级字符集主要通过配置文件进行设置,包括`/etc/locale.conf`、`/etc/sysconfig/i18n`(适用于某些Red Hat系发行版)等

    以下以修改`/etc/locale.conf`为例: sudo nano /etc/locale.conf 将文件中的以下内容修改为所需的字符集设置,例如UTF-8: LANG=en_US.UTF-8 LC_CTYPE=en_US.UTF-8 LC_NUMERIC=en_US.UTF-8 LC_TIME=e

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道